Experiments of Babar in 2009 measured \gamma^* \gamma \rightarrow \pi^0 transition form factor and reported an ultraviolet enhamcement in disaccord with long standing asymptotic QCD predictions triggering a multitude new theoretical auggestions. Employ Schwinger-Dyson equations, we present a self-consistent treatments of the pion, which connects its static properties and elastic and transition form factors. The asymptotic DSE results employing an interaction that preserves the one-loop renormalization group behavior of QCD, agree with the perturbative QCD predictions computed in the pioneering work of Brodsky and Lepage two decades ago. These results are also in agreement with all the existing experimental data with an exception of the large-Q2 BaBar data with which they disagree markedly. Our analysis supports a view that the large-Q^2 data obtained by the BaBar-Collaboration is not an accurate measure of the \gamma^* \gamma \rightarrow \pi^0 form factor. Then how does the conflict get resolved? |
